In one of the finest cliff top locations in Cornwall stands Carn Eve, a wonderfully spacious detached seven bedroom holiday home set over 3 floors with private beach access to the beautiful Gwenver Beach which adjoins the iconic Sennen Cove. Situated eight miles from Penzance and four miles along the coast from Lands End this magnificent house offers a family holiday that will never be forgotten. From the moment you arrive along the private lane to the house you will be mesmerised with the amazing uninterrupted sea views where on a clear day even the Isles of Scilly are visible. Entering the house you pass the games room which will prove a hit with the children before coming to the magnificent sitting room. Here the huge windows on three sides give breathtaking views whatever the time of year and whatever the weather. From watching the storms in the winter in front of a roaring log fire to watching the dolphins playing in the bay on long summer days, this really is a superb room. From here a wraparound decked area provides the perfect setting for private sunbathing or alfresco dining. There are seven bedrooms here with various sleeping combinations to suit all and five bathrooms. With a choice of beaches along this world-famous coastline to select from you will be spoilt for choice. Gwenver Beach, reached by a private footpath right below the house is certain to become a favourite, offering some of the best surfing conditions in Cornwall and being difficult for the general public to reach rarely becomes too crowded. A special house in a stunning location to be enjoyed all year round.
Sennen Cove is a small fishing village situated close to Land's End. The village has a lifeboat station, church, a couple of shops and a café. The town of St Just is close by and has several monuments, prehistoric antiquities, a town hall, a church, shops and pubs. Also the town of Penzance is within reach where day trips to the Scilly Isles can be enjoyed.

We had a great holiday which, however, was nearly spoiled by things which went wrong in the house. At the price charged these surely shouldn't have been happening. Luckily, Jason the caretaker was available to try to rectify as many the problems as he could. We had blocked showers which twice caused water to leak though ceilings near electrics and got things wet in the rooms below the leaks. We had a horrendous outbreak of flies (16 at one point) in a top floor bedroom, especially. It was impossible to sleep there and we had to convert a reception room into a bedroom carrying a foldup bed up and down steep stairs. Hence, we lost one reception room. A very noisy bathroom vent which kept us awake at night when it was windy. A broken curtain pole so the curtain was useless in a bedroom. A broken dining room chair. A very slow oven. These things caused stress, discomfort and difficulty. If only the owner would invest care and attention in these things and solved the problems Carn Eve could be absolutely glorious!
